New photos released as search for missing woman continues

Thursday, October 23, 2025 at 8:56 AM

Comox Valley RCMP have released new photos as they continue to search for a 40-year-old woman missing since last week.

Ashley Bosma was reported missing on Thursday, October 16.

Police have now received two new photos -  one showing her hair the way it appeared when she was last seen, and another obtained on surveillance footage from Friday, October 10.

The photos were only recently provided to investigators and are being shared now to assist the public in recognizing her as search efforts continue.

Police say investigators have been following up on every single tip from the public - they say there have been many – and thoroughly reviewing all available information. 

Police have confirmed that Ashley was last seen camping near Comox Lake in Cumberland on Tuesday October 14, two days before being reported missing. It’s possible she may have entered nearby trails, been picked up, or walked to another unknown location.

Ashley was last known to be wearing pink leggings and a grey sweater. She has blue eyes, is approximately 5’4” tall and 115 lbs.

If you have any information, please contact the Comox Valley RCMP at (250) 338-1321.

Keeping Our Word

 

The word "éy7á7juuthem" means “Language of our People” and is the ancestral tongue of the Homalco, Tla’amin, Klahoose and K’ómoks First Nations, with dialectic differences in each community.

It is pronounced "eye-ya-jooth-hem."
